Трюк JavaScript, який більшість розробників пропускає

Чи знаєте ви, що в JavaScript можна деструктурувати функції?

Ми всі знайомі з деструктуруванням об'єктів та масивів, але ось вам потужний прийом: 〰️ деструктурування методів 〰️ безпосередньо з об'єктів для чистішого та більш багаторазового коду.

Приклад:

const { log, warn, error } = console;   

log('Це запис у лог');   
warn('Це попередження');   
error('Це помилка');

🔍 Чому це корисно?
✔️ Скорочує повторюваний код, особливо коли працюєте з методами, які використовуються часто.
✔️ Робить ваш код більш модульним і зручним для читання.
✔️ Підходить і для ваших власних об'єктів!

💡 Порада:
⏩ Використовуйте це з бібліотеками, як-от lodash чи axios, щоб підключати лише те, що вам потрібно, заощаджуючи час і підвищуючи зрозумілість коду.

〰️ Який крутий трюк JavaScript ви любите використовувати? Поділіться ним у коментарях! 〰️

JavaScript #ПорадиЗКодування #ВебРозробка #ХакиПрограмування #ФронтендРозробка

Давайте підключимося на Linkedin: @initeshjain

Перекладено з: A JavaScript Trick Most Developers Miss

Leave a Reply

Your email address will not be published. Required fields are marked *